New York Book-Bindery. Established 1836. Burnt down January 23d. 1852. Rebuilt May 1st, 1852

New York: Edward Walker & Sons, 1852. Illustrated broadside, approx. 17" x 15" (not examined out of old frame); generally very good with no folds or breaks. The New York Book Bindery was established by Edward Walker in 1836. This advertisement was printed in 1852 after the original building burned down, and announced the opening of the new, larger building at the same location. Delaware only in OCLC. Item #50916
